Part of the problem may be that there are many different designs of phoenix out there and quite a lot of them dont have any form of card detect circuitry. If you try to use card detect with these readers then you can get odd results ranging from nothing at all (no card ever detected) to the reader running when no card is inserted and giving all kinds of strange random data.........

You could also have normal or inverse reset, again it depends on the particular phoenix design.

Dont think the Irdeto/Seca stuff has any effect unless your actually using those card types so you could probably simplify the section a little more.
